That being said, the fact that the majority of the Mauritshuis’ unbearably amazing collection was moved from its home in the center of the city to the Gemeentemuseum outside of the hustle and bustle and U.N. dealings actually ended up being kind of  blessing in disguise. Not only is the museum building a gorgeous one, designed by H.P. Berlage, a member of the Amsterdam School, which pleased my mother, but  it also currently houses an awesome if vaguely confusing exhibit called Mondriaan and De Stijl, which is fantastic, and they have most of the marvels of the Mauritshuis (except the damn girl with the damn pearl earring which is in JAPAN, are you kidding me? Not cool, Holland, NOT COOL.)

But they also have an exhibit that might actually be relevant on this here sewing blog, and that was one entitled Fabulous Fifties, Fabulous Fashion! It was a pretty cool exhibit, not all that revelatory and trying to paint Holland as the center of fashion development, which, well….

But still, it has some just simply gorgeous pieces, Vintage Dior and Givenchy and even some modern things. And they let you take photos, so, um….
